Hey, i'll explain. Once you have completed EVERY single mission on the start chart (you can check in your profile stats), you get access to arbitrations, and you can start the Steel Path by talking to Teshin in one of the relays. The arbitrations are important because they drop Vitus Essence which you'll need to buy the important Galvanized mods
